Как сделать так, чтобы в комментариях к TortoiseHG фиксировалась ссылка Case / Bug? - PullRequest
4 голосов
/ 20 июня 2011

Мы пытаемся заставить TortoiseHG 2.0.5 проверить, что в случае комментирования был введен номер дела fogbugz, исследования показали, что в TortoiseHG имеется «обязательная ссылка на проблему», которая требует, чтобы link.regex был действительным.Мы уже используем ссылку Issue and Issue с ​​выражением fogbugz, чтобы преобразовать случай в ссылку на сайт fogbugz, чтобы это работало.Все, что мы хотим сделать, это принудительно / напомнить, что в комментарии к фиксации набора изменений необходимо ввести регистр

Параметр «Обязательная ссылка на проблему» не отображается в пользовательском интерфейсе этой версии, мы отредактировали файл настроекдобавив «issue.linkmandatory = True», но это, похоже, не работает.

Любые идеи, если это должно работать или как добиться того, чего мы хотим.

Большое спасибо

1 Ответ

1 голос
/ 06 июля 2011

TortoiseHg прошел серьезную переписку между 1.1.9 и 2.0, где базовая структура графического интерфейса была изменена с GTK на Qt. Это означало, что практически весь функционал пришлось переписать. Функции, которые не использовались разработчиками или не запрашивались сообществом, просто не были перенесены.

Я предлагаю вам сначала поднять вопрос в списке рассылки пользователей tortoisehg-обсуждения, либо по электронной почте tortoisehg-discuss@lists.sourceforge.net, либо через веб-форум gmane списка рассылки .

Если нет способа сконфигурировать новую версию, чтобы получить желаемое поведение, вы могли бы поднять ее как проблему улучшения на https://bitbucket.org/tortoisehg/thg/issues?status=new&status=open - но единственным 100% -ным определенным способом получить эту функцию было бы предложить ресурсы для разработки, которые могут портировать функцию. Команда TortoiseHg обычно очень помогает. Вам не нужно глубокое понимание GTK, Qt или TortoiseHg - просто какое-то время, чтобы сделать это. Я думаю, это можно сделать через день или два.

...